Sustainable Living Workshop

Course Overview

How can you reduce your carbon footprint in the reality of your own life? Using the solar- and wind-powered homestead at Round River Farm as a classroom, this workshop will provide a jumping off point to making environmentally sustainable decisions for yourself. We’ll look at the big picture as well as examine the specifics of transportation, water use, wastewater re-use, growing and cooking food, producing your own electricity and hot water, and choosing building designs and materials. Both rural and urban scenarios will be addressed in this workshop. Demonstrations, presentations, discussions and even some games will be interspersed with work on an individual plan of action that participants will take home with them. Prepare to be challenged and inspired as David and Lise Abazs invite you to their homestead. Note: This course takes place on the Round River Farm (48 miles southwest of Grand Marais - in Finland, MN).
